jQuery中的bind()方法用于將一個或多個事件綁定到選擇器匹配的元素上。
其中,最常用的就是將點擊事件綁定到元素上:
$(selector).bind("click", function(){ //執行的代碼 });
在上述代碼中,selector指的是你要綁定點擊事件的元素,而function則是你要執行的代碼塊。
bind()方法還有另外一種寫法:
$(selector).bind({ click: function(){ //執行的代碼 }, mouseover: function(){ //執行的代碼 } });
在這種寫法中,你可以同時綁定多個事件(如上例所示的點擊事件和鼠標滑過事件),并在每個事件后跟上對應的執行代碼。
從jQuery 1.7開始,用on()方法代替bind()方法可以更簡潔地實現綁定事件:
$(selector).on("click", function(){ //執行的代碼 });
on()方法的語法與bind()方法的語法相似,只是改了個名字而已。用法也非常簡單。
總之,無論是使用bind()還是on()方法,都能很好地將事件與元素綁定起來,使頁面交互更加靈活和友好。